Rated: PG
Synopsis: Before creating the monumental Planet Earth, producer Alastair
Fothergill and his team from the BBC put together one of the most
breathtaking explorations of the world's oceans ever assembled, The
Blue Planet: Seas of Life.
The winner of two Emmy® Awards, The Blue
Planet: Seas of Life is the definitive exploration of the marine world,
chronicling the mysteries of the deep in ways never before imagined. It
is now being re-released in an all-new special edition, with an added
5th disc of bonus programming not included in the original DVD release.

Rated: NR
Starring: Corey Carrier, Sean Patrick Flanery, Lloyd Owen, Ruth de Sosa, Margaret Tyzac
Based on the popular Indiana Jones film series starring Harrison Ford, The Adventures of Young Indiana Jones chronicles the early years of the main character, both as a young boy and a young man.
Filmed in locations throughout the world, the series takes the viewer through Indy"s life lessons and his many encounters with famous historical figures.

Rated: R
Starring: Daniel Benzali, Deanna Russo, Johnny Messner, and Jeri Lynn Ryan
Director: Daniel Myrick
Synopsis: While on duty, David Vaughn (Messner) and Victor Hernandez (Huertas), two emergency paramedics, receive a call from a young girl whose mother has lost consciousness in a deserted area, but they soon discover that the life they have to save may be their own.
Kidnapped and locked in an isolated building, David tries to discover the truth behind a secret cult and their beliefs. As Victor's beliefs are challenged and the fine-line between religion and science are crossed, David must find a way to escape and get out, before "they" get him. In a society where beliefs in religion and beliefs in science are constantly challenged, Believers explores the manipulative measures some use to take advantage of lost souls.

Starring: The HBCU Marching Bands (and Special Guests)
Directed by: Michael Drumm
After years of audiences wanting a DVD of Honda's Battle of the Bands (HBOB) performances at the Georgia Dome, their wishes have been granted. The top ten Historically Black College and University (HBCU) marching bands have made it to the television screen with the DVD Documentary Stompin' at the Dome.
Each band works their way to the Georgia Dome during the fall, mastering the drills for a stellar and solid performance in January at the Dome.
